The Lettermen Christmas Nov. 27 at the MAC

Three-part vocal group The Lettermen will present a holiday show at 3 p.m. Sunday, Nov. 27, at the McAninch Arts Center at College of DuPage, 425 Fawell Blvd. in Glen Ellyn.

The group, which originally formed in the late 1950s, released its first single, “Their Hearts Were Full of Spring,” more than 46 years ago. The Lettermen are known for their soft melodies and seamless sound on recordings, including, “Cherish/Precious and Few” and “World Without Love.”

Their Nov. 27 holiday show features a selection of traditional Christmas favorites and Lettermen hits.

Original members Tony Butala, Donovan Tea and Bobby Poynton perform hundreds of concerts each year and in 2001, The Lettermen were inducted into the Vocal Group Hall of Fame.

Throughout their lengthy career, The Lettermen have had 32 consecutive Billboard Magazine chart albums, 11 Gold records and five Grammy nominations.
